dataholz.eu provides architects, designers, building authorities and builders with a collection of data regarding thermal, acoustic, fire and ecological performance levels for wood and wood-based materials, building materials, components and component connections for timber construction. All the approved parameters have been published with the consent of accredited testing institutes and are admitted for use by the construction supervising authority without further testing or proof.

Expensive proofs regarding thermal, acoustic, fire and ecological performance levels by the user can be substituted by a reference to or a submission of these datasheets. The utilization of timber in building construction is easily facilitated and the planning phase for a project shortened. Documents required to demonstrate compliance with building codes are available with one mouse-click.

Since the catalogue is implemented using a database, users can quickly and easily access the information required by selecting a structural timber component or a parameter relating to thermal, acoustic or fire performance levels . The content of the catalogue is continuously being updated and expanded.
